Typical off-peak travel time from Newtown to four key destinations.


Sydney Central
5min
Parramatta
30min
Chatswood
20min
Sydney Airport
18min
Newtown station is five minutes from Central on the T3 Bankstown line. One of the best-connected inner-west suburbs for CBD commuters.
How we calculated this
Times reflect typical off-peak public-transport journeys from Newtown. Walking time from your door to the station is not included. Real journeys vary by time of day, line disruptions, and where your workplace actually sits. For a specific trip, check the TfNSW Trip Planner.
